Selecting the Right Shrink Plastic for Your Product
Selecting the best shrink film can seem challenging, but it's essential to guarantee your product's presentation and protection during shipping. Consider the dimension and configuration of your package; robust film is needed for substantial items, while a thinner option may be adequate for compact products. In addition, think about the environment the package will encounter; freezing environments may demand a more durable plastic to prevent splitting. Finally, consider your cost as plastic rates differ depending on gauge and material.
- Assess goods scale.
- Know the required film weight.
- Account for temperature factors.
- Compare pricing from different vendors.

Troubleshooting Common Shrink Film Problems
Experiencing issues with your shrink sleeve? Several common problems can occur , but most are readily addressed with a little of knowledge . One frequent issue is uneven shrinking , often caused by fluctuating heat settings . Ensure your heat gun is maintaining a stable temperature and moving at a steady speed. Wrinkling or pouching can result from excessive heat, or sometimes, from chilly film, so adjust accordingly. If the film is breaking, it could indicate a defect in the sheet itself, or high tension during application . Finally, static stickiness can be reduced by using an antistatic solution or adjusting the moisture in your operating area.
